Establish a Cleaning Routine
One of the most effective ways to manage cleaning tasks is to establish a routine. A cleaning schedule can prevent overwhelming feelings while ensuring all areas of your home receive the attention they deserve. Here are some tips to create a successful cleaning routine:
-
Daily Tasks:
Focus on tasks that need to be done every day, such as making the beds, washing dishes, and wiping down surfaces. These small tasks can make a significant difference. -
Weekly Chores:
Designate specific days for tasks like vacuuming, dusting, and cleaning bathrooms. -
Monthly Deep Cleaning:
Set aside time each month for deeper cleaning tasks, like washing windows and scrubbing floors.
Declutter Regularly
Decluttering is a critical step in maintaining a tidy space. Excess belongings can create chaos and make cleaning more difficult. To declutter effectively:
-
Sort and Organize:
Go through each room and organize items into categories: keep, donate, and discard. Be honest about what you really use and need. -
Use Storage Solutions:
Invest in storage solutions like bins, baskets, and shelves to keep your belongings organized. -
Implement the One-In-One-Out Rule:
For every new item you bring into your home, consider removing one existing item.

Embrace the Power of the 15-Minute Clean
When overwhelmed by the thought of a big cleaning job, try the 15-minute clean concept. This involves setting a timer for 15 minutes and focusing on cleaning as much as possible within that time frame. Pick a room or area to clean and go to town! This technique encourages quick bursts of productivity, making cleaning feel less like a chore.

Develop Quick Cleaning Habits
Incorporate small cleaning habits into your daily routine to prevent messes from accumulating. Here are some quick tips:
-
Clean as You Go:
Whether cooking or doing crafts, clean up immediately after finishing to avoid clutter. -
Keep Cleaning Supplies Accessible:
Store cleaning supplies in convenient locations throughout your home to make it easier to clean up spills and mess. -
Do a Quick Sweep:
Take a few minutes at the end of each day to do a quick scan of your living space to pick up stray items or clutter.

Understand the Importance of Ventilation
Good ventilation in your home is essential for maintaining a healthy atmosphere. Proper airflow helps to keep your space smelling fresh and reduces the likelihood of mold and dust buildup. Regularly open windows to let fresh air in, consider using exhaust fans, and keep your home well-aired to promote a clean environment.
